SHOP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2016 in Review

179 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Shopify (SHOP) for Q3 2016, worth a combined $2.27B — up 66% from $1.37B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 76 funds opened new SHOP positions and 21 closed out — a net gain of 55 holders — while 61 added to existing stakes and 30 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$66.4M. The largest seller was Insight Holdings Group, exiting entirely with an estimated $75.2M sold.
